Re: Can we adjust for DST?
If an event on your calendar happens at on Day X at 1PM, then it should happen at 1PM regardless of DST or not. For example, the Nightly News is always on at 6PM, regardless of whether or not we are in DST.

Internally, our servers run GMT, and (depending on the country and timezone you are in) we will take DST (if observed) into account when sending event reminders.

I'm not sure how you are constructing the dates on your iOS app, but if you can't force an event to be created with the time you specific (without auto-adjusting) then you would need to determine in DST is in effect and adjust accordingly. This is hugely complicated as it varies across the globe. I would strongly recommend more research on the iOS side of things.
